TL;DR Summary

Former President Donald Trump and President Joe Biden won the New Hampshire primaries, with Trump securing the Republican nomination and Biden winning as a write-in candidate. The U.S. Education Department will fix a $1.8 billion math mistake in the Free Application for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A) in time for the 2024-2025 school year. Additionally, Life Kit's resolution planner offers tips for nurturing relationships, and Crystal Hefner's memoir sheds light on the Playboy Mansion's history.
